Commit Graph

367 Commits

Author SHA1 Message Date
josantos bbb254ef43 reformatting
Signed-off-by: josantos <josantos@amd.com>
2023-08-10 11:16:50 -05:00
josantos 59d77f9d81 Names shortened/demangled after join_prof
-  Added kernelVerbose flag in profile_group
-  Added KernelVerbose flag in analyze_group
-  Analyze replaces csv with shortened/demangled name
-  csv_converter uses llvm-cxxfilt

Signed-off-by: josantos <josantos@amd.com>
2023-08-10 11:13:27 -05:00
josantos 2948f73ae8 keep converter in csv_converter.py
Signed-off-by: josantos <josantos@amd.com>
2023-08-09 10:46:57 -05:00
JoseSantosAMD 76da2a9ed5 Merge branch 'dev' of https://github.com/AMDResearch/omniperf into kernel_name_mappings 2023-08-08 14:49:59 -05:00
JoseSantosAMD 4e51c122d1 removing calls to kernel_name_shortener in mongo
shortening now in profile

Signed-off-by: JoseSantosAMD <josantos@amd.com>
2023-08-08 12:06:39 -05:00
Cole Ramos c809346b1b Merge pull request #155 from arghdos/bf16_flops
fix max BF16 flop rate on CDNA2
2023-08-03 15:36:45 -07:00
JoseSantosAMD add68ded67 reformatting
Signed-off-by: JoseSantosAMD <Jose.Santos@amd.com>
2023-08-02 13:55:08 -05:00
coleramos425 4e58f0ba2e Only load required archs into ArchConfig datastruct (#144)
Signed-off-by: coleramos425 <colramos@amd.com>
2023-08-02 12:51:51 -05:00
coleramos425 0f96a8d1e5 Fix incorrect ordering of args in perfagg func
Signed-off-by: coleramos425 <colramos@amd.com>
2023-08-02 12:50:34 -05:00
JoseSantosAMD b63332a317 Use llvm-cxxfilt to demangle names
Show typed text in in dash-dropdown input box

Signed-off-by: JoseSantosAMD <Jose.Santos@amd.com>
2023-08-02 12:38:56 -05:00
Cole Ramos 83a8577ff3 Merge pull request #151 from JoseSantosAMD/bug_141
Update Grafana Plugin
2023-08-01 13:47:48 -05:00
JoseSantosAMD 9360ed8b0c Use llvm-cxxfilt to demangle names in kernel_name_shortener
Signed-off-by: JoseSantosAMD <Jose.Santos@amd.com>
2023-07-31 14:19:26 -05:00
Nicholas Curtis 42248d5391 fix max BF16 flop rate on CDNA2
Signed-off-by: Nicholas Curtis <nicurtis@amd.com>
2023-07-28 12:38:11 -04:00
colramos-amd 6487ba3853 New simple_charts utility
Signed-off-by: colramos-amd <colramos@amd.com>
2023-07-18 16:04:31 -05:00
colramos-amd 479eb66d95 Add figure styling to YML configs
Signed-off-by: colramos-amd <colramos@amd.com>
2023-07-18 16:03:21 -05:00
JoseSantosAMD d7ba2acec9 Adding config files
Signed-off-by: JoseSantosAMD <Jose.Santos@amd.com>
2023-07-17 13:19:03 -05:00
colramos-amd 2b0ac9b5d8 Enable join_prof() merge util to be called from outside Omniperf
Signed-off-by: colramos-amd <colramos@amd.com>
2023-07-17 13:12:56 -05:00
colramos-amd fd55a69805 Filter additional ops in gen_counter_list fucn
Signed-off-by: colramos-amd <colramos@amd.com>
2023-07-17 13:12:22 -05:00
JoseSantosAMD 43d492dce2 Adding config files
Signed-off-by: JoseSantosAMD <Jose.Santos@amd.com>
2023-07-17 13:02:00 -05:00
JoseSantosAMD 3137076a72 Migrate to @grafana/create-plugin
Signed-off-by: JoseSantosAMD <Jose.Santos@amd.com>
2023-07-17 12:46:05 -05:00
colramos-amd 4d8383b439 Comply to Python formatting
Signed-off-by: colramos-amd <colramos@amd.com>
2023-07-11 14:14:10 -05:00
colramos-amd 80c04feb77 Abstract perfmon coalesing for useage in rocomni plugin
Signed-off-by: colramos-amd <colramos@amd.com>
2023-07-11 14:13:09 -05:00
colramos-amd 267750c085 Rearranging build_df func to optimize ArchConfig for rocomni plugin
Signed-off-by: colramos-amd <colramos@amd.com>
2023-07-11 14:11:38 -05:00
Cole Ramos b5b7f50b59 Merge pull request #146 from JoseSantosAMD/enhancement_133
Enhancement #133
2023-07-11 13:29:52 -05:00
Cole Ramos 6042cfb16a Update 1800_L2_cache_per_channel.yaml
Capitalizing for consistency

Signed-off-by: Cole Ramos <colramos@amd.com>
2023-07-11 13:29:07 -05:00
Cole Ramos 2469716d13 Update 1800_L2_cache_per_channel.yaml
Capitalizing for consistency

Signed-off-by: Cole Ramos <colramos@amd.com>
2023-07-11 13:27:46 -05:00
JoseSantosAMD 5d84d0bb63 Fixed Units inconsistencies
-  Table 10: Units were output as "$normUnit" now they are instr + normUnit

-  Table 16: Changed to Req per $normUnit

Signed-off-by: JoseSantosAMD <Jose.Santos@amd.com>
2023-07-10 16:26:56 -05:00
JoseSantosAMD 2d28360c3e Merge branch 'dev' of https://github.com/AMDResearch/omniperf into enhancement_133 2023-07-10 11:03:31 -05:00
Nicholas Curtis ecc39861b5 apply formatting
Signed-off-by: Nicholas Curtis <nicurtis@amd.com>
2023-06-30 15:58:41 -05:00
Nicholas Curtis c03298e367 Add options to enable latexpdf builds
Signed-off-by: Nicholas Curtis <nicurtis@amd.com>
2023-06-30 15:58:17 -05:00
Nicholas Curtis 65d263b14e fix missing
Signed-off-by: Nicholas Curtis <nicurtis@amd.com>
2023-06-30 15:57:03 -05:00
Nicholas Curtis e8bceca531 fix formatting
Signed-off-by: Nicholas Curtis <nicurtis@amd.com>
2023-06-30 15:56:53 -05:00
Nicholas Curtis 5b3a8d5075 Incorporate review comments
Signed-off-by: Nicholas Curtis <nicurtis@amd.com>
2023-06-30 15:56:33 -05:00
Karl W. Schulz 8edba713fb updating path for rocm repo to supported rhel8 release (8.8)
Signed-off-by: Karl W. Schulz <karl.schulz@amd.com>
2023-06-30 15:01:57 -05:00
Nicholas Curtis be1eeee370 apply formatting
Signed-off-by: Nicholas Curtis <nicurtis@amd.com>
2023-06-30 14:46:23 -05:00
Nicholas Curtis 60d4a42536 Add options to enable latexpdf builds
Signed-off-by: Nicholas Curtis <nicurtis@amd.com>
2023-06-30 14:46:23 -05:00
Nicholas Curtis 8857393571 fix missing
Signed-off-by: Nicholas Curtis <nicurtis@amd.com>
2023-06-30 14:46:23 -05:00
Nicholas Curtis aaed37d004 fix formatting
Signed-off-by: Nicholas Curtis <nicurtis@amd.com>
2023-06-30 14:46:23 -05:00
Nicholas Curtis 54bc058085 Incorporate review comments
Signed-off-by: Nicholas Curtis <nicurtis@amd.com>
2023-06-30 14:46:23 -05:00
coleramos425 f91de7d2f7 Comply to Python formatting
Signed-off-by: coleramos425 <colramos@amd.com>
2023-06-26 15:38:51 -05:00
coleramos425 a89cb96b69 Extend filtering into timestamps.csv (#80)
Signed-off-by: coleramos425 <colramos@amd.com>
2023-06-26 15:30:38 -05:00
colramos-amd 049ba12f69 Add subsection title to System Speed-of-Light
Signed-off-by: colramos-amd <colramos@amd.com>
2023-06-21 11:06:03 -05:00
colramos-amd 79eecb445e Comply to Python formatting
Signed-off-by: colramos-amd <colramos@amd.com>
2023-06-09 10:04:32 -05:00
colramos-amd 5f6c776170 Omniperf rocomni changes
Signed-off-by: colramos-amd <colramos@amd.com>
2023-06-09 10:01:37 -05:00
colramos-amd acb9729540 Fix VGPR issue (#139)
Signed-off-by: colramos-amd <colramos@amd.com>
2023-06-09 10:00:56 -05:00
Cole Ramos a346db7646 Update Zenodo
Signed-off-by: Cole Ramos <colramos@amd.com>
2023-05-31 10:31:39 -05:00
coleramos425 62304b8543 Suppress verbose output
Signed-off-by: coleramos425 <colramos@amd.com>
2023-05-30 17:03:22 -05:00
coleramos425 2daeb1bc74 Correct typo in Agg L2 per channel stats for mi100
Signed-off-by: coleramos425 <colramos@amd.com>
2023-05-30 15:44:43 -05:00
coleramos425 b8cf891e5e Update version
Signed-off-by: coleramos425 <colramos@amd.com>
2023-05-30 14:50:39 -05:00
coleramos425 2049e56eb2 Comply to Python formatting
Signed-off-by: coleramos425 <colramos@amd.com>
2023-05-30 13:40:49 -05:00